The 34-year-old X Factor vocal producer -- and mastermind behind Britney Spears' "If U Seek Amy," Justin Bieber's "Beauty and a Beat" and multiple One Direction hits including 2012's "Live While We're Young" -- is currently in the studio with the series' fourth-place finishers Emblem3, executive producing their debut album under his newly formed Syco imprint, Mr. Kanani.
But while Kotecha might be new to the label-head thing, he's a vet when it comes to creating infectious pop pleasures. Among his crowning achievements? One Direction's "What Makes You Beautiful," which Kotecha wrote for his wife when she complained of feeling "ugly." "I was like, 'No, you look beautiful. You don't know how beautiful you look,' and then I was like, 'Oh crap! That's a good song. Hold on!' and I wrote it down," he recalls with a chuckle. "That's a couple of Valentine's Days and Christmas presents already there. If I ever forget one day, I'll just be like, 'Hey, remember 'What Makes You Beautiful'?"
